# Runbook: Hunting leaked file descriptors in Quillgate

When the `fd_open` gauge climbs steadily between deploys, suspect a leak rather than load. First confirm on a single pod: exec in and count entries under `/proc/1/fd`, noting how many are sockets in CLOSE_WAIT versus regular files. Capture two snapshots ten minutes apart before restarting anything — we need the delta for the postmortem. Reproduce locally with the Marbury load harness, which requires the service running with the following configuration values.

settings of yagep-bajog:
[istdor]
port = 4000
region = south-2
host = istdor.qorvelcorp.internal
timeout_ms = 5000
retries = 5

Briefing: Logistics Provider Transition — Leadership Review

For the incoming director: after an eight-month evaluation, we are moving regional distribution from Brastow Freight to Ondelle Carriers, effective next quarter. Ondelle offers consolidated routing through the Kelmsford hub, improved cold-chain coverage, and penalty clauses tied to on-time delivery. Transition risks are documented in Appendix C. The commercial considerations behind this change are set out in the confidential note that follows.

board note of kageg-bahof: The renewal with Holwynax Holdings closes at $2 million a year, 5 percent below the last contract. Project Ulaath slips by two quarters because of the supplier delay.

Leadership Review — Project Bellwick Delay

Finance folks, heads up: Bellwick (the inventory system migration) is running about ten weeks behind. Testing at the Harlow depot surfaced data issues, and Marit's team needs extra contractor hours to fix them. Revised costs go to the review board Friday. For context, here's what leadership is weighing.

internal memo for kahop-yajof: The steering committee signed off on a budget of $12.6 million for Project Jorwyn. The renewal with Quenoxox Logistics closes at $16.8 million a year, 48 percent above the last contract.